Saturday 5 January until Tuesday 8 January 2019

The 2019 biennial conference of our association allows teachers to come together to learn about current knowledge related to stage 4, 5 and 6 agriculture curriculums. The agriculture and technology mandatory syllabuses contain both practical and theory content needs, so the conference aims to satisfy knowledge and learning development in both these areas.

The conference will have two days of farm industry visits that will involve teachers gaining both theory and practical understanding of a range of topics. There will be a range of sessions about animal and plant production, farm management, sustainability, development of curriculum and planning of curriculum. A number of industry and education experts will be presenting formal presentations to teachers, both on farm and in workshops.

Farm visits will occur on Saturday 5 and Sunday 6 January from 8.30am to 5.30pm.

On Monday 7 January there will be industry, saleyard and seed company visits in the morning followed by rotating workshops from 11.30am to 5.00pm,.
